Preliminary Phytochemical Evaluation of Seed Extracts of Cucurbita Maxima Duchense

2013 
Cucurbita maxima Duchense (family:Cucurbitaceae) is a trailing annual herb, widely cultivated throughout India and in most warm regions of the world, for used as vegetables as well as medicines. The present study deals with preliminary physicochemical and phytochemical evaluation of seed extract of Cucurbita maxima. The study includes preparation of different extracts by successive solvent extraction for detailed analysis. Different physicochemical parameters such as ash value (total ash, acid insoluble ash and water soluble ash value), loss on drying, alcohol soluble and water soluble extractive value, percentage yield of successive solvent extracts and phytochemical evaluation of different extracts of Cucurbita maxima were carried out as per standard recommended physicochemical determinations and authentic phytochemical procedures. Preliminary phytochemical evaluation on different extracts of seed of Cucurbita maxima reveals the presence of proteins, carbohydrates, flavanoids, saponins and tannins
